内容提要:
Many of the most admired of Debussy's piano works, reprinted from authoritative French editions, among them the Etudes (1915), and the magical Children's Corner (1906–8). Also includes Nocturne (1892), Piece pour piano (1903–4), Images, Book II (1907), Hommage a Haydn (1910), The Little Nigar (1909), La plus que lente (1910), Elegie (1915), more.
